Written in the 1930’s for a film, later covered by the Flamingo’s in 1959.

Formed in the 50’s, an incarnation of the band is still touring. It says a lot about the quality of the music and the group’s performers. They helped define Doo-Wop.

In 1998 the song was used in a Pepsi commercial without consent. The owners sued and were awarded $250K. I think that Pepsi got off easy, no excuse for what they did.
